Transaction 75c4373a47df1608c9a16cac5328093dbe9c6c174ef67da28223dfb6f6bd66d4

block
259902ee88d4794c7cb19ea4520025786d9836fb5f9813349db574186901f4fe

1 Input

2 Outputs